Системні шини мікропроцесорів

Главная » Каталог статей » Статьи на украинском » Мікропроцесори » Системні шини мікропроцесорів

Шина даних (ШД) представляють собою набір двонаправлених сигнальних ліній з 3-ма станами, у якому паралельно передають двійкову інформацію (у кожній лінії передають 1 біт). МП маєть 8, 16 і 32 розрядні ШД. Кількість ліній, тобто ширина шини, визначає максимальну величину числа, яке можна передати по цій шині: 8 біт дозволяє передавати числа 0…255, 16 біт – 0…65535.

Можливість суміжного виконання ШД багато чисельними пристроями забезпечує шиноформувач з 3-ма станами.

До ШД може приєднуватися велика кількість приймачів, отже у певний момент часу можуть бути розблоковані декілька приймачів, але дані призначають для одного із них, тому формується спеціальний сигнал (строб) даних, який повідомляє вибраним приймачам, що дані на ШД призначені саме їм.

На рис.1 вказана базова МП система (МПС).

image

Рис.1

Кожний пристрій, що передає на ШД повинен мати формувач з 3-ма станами на кожну лінію ШД. Шині формувачі відкриваються вхідними сигналами вибору мікросхеми, після чого інформація з даного пристрою передається на ШД.

Шина адреси (ША) – це група однонапрямлених сигнальних ліній, за допомогою яких МП відмічає пристрій, в який або з якого повинна бути передана інформація. Кожне двійкове число на ША може позначати конкретну область пам’яті, що з’єднується з МП через ШД і може обмінюватися з ним даними. У свою чергу така пам’ять може представляти собою або комірку ЗП, або регістр, що входить до складу портів введення чи виведення.

Шина управління (ШУ) – представляє сигнал управління, який генерується МП і координує весь процес інформаційного обміну. Головна відмінність ШУ від ША І ШД у тому, що кожна її лінія виконує свою єдину дану функцію.

Вхідні сигнали МП використовуються для керування передачі даних, а також у якості сигналів-відповідей на вхідні.

Оставьте комментарий к статье